Abstract

본 발명은 조성식(1-y)CaTiO3-yLa(Zn1-x/2Mgx/2Ti1/2)O3로 표시되고, x의 범위가 0≤x≤1.0이고 y의 범위가 0.3≤y≤0.9인 고주파용 유전체 조성물을 제공한다. 이 조성물은 유전율이 28.6 내지 58.6이고 QxFo(GHz)가 29,330 내지 71,100이며, 공진 주파수의 온도 계수(TCF)가 -53.82 내지 +52.32ppm/℃로서, 고주파용 유전채 세라믹스가 요구되는 통신 시스템에 적합하게 사용할 수 있다.

Claims (1)

  1. 하기 조성식으로 나타내어지는 고주파용 유전체 조성물.
    (1-y)CaTiO3-yLa(Zn1-x/2Mgx/2Ti1/2)O3
    식중, 0≤x≤1.0, 0.3≤y≤0.9.
